The Ancient Roman city of Herculaneum was buried by Mount Vesuvius 2000 years ago and it came back to light during the last century. We will admire stunning views of the Volcano and of the Bay of Naples. We will learn what happened during that terrific eruption. We will visit ancient houses, Bath-Houses, little shops, taverns. We will enter the daily life of the average Roman. We will admire incredible frescoes and mosaics. We will be awe-stricken by the dreadful skeletons!
We will walk approximately two hours to discover the archaeological park and the little museum. Herculaneum is more compact than Pompeii, better preserved, and easier to visit. About Sorrento

Sorrento is a charming coastal town on the Amalfi Coast, known for its stunning views, lemon groves, and historic center. It's a gateway to the Amalfi Coast and offers a mix of relaxation, culture, and adventure.
